Our November Visit to Joybells
It was great to be back at Joybells for a week at the beginning of November. The progress that has been made on the buildings is great to see although there is still a lot to be done to finish all the work. This is mainly in the areas of plumbing, electrical fittings, decorating and generally equipping the buildings. We are in the process of making financial assessments of how much will be needed to see each particular part of the work finished.
The fact that there is now a constant supply of water available has made a huge difference but Joy is still waiting for various permissions to be granted that would make life easier for all the staff. For example a licence is needed to use bottled gas for cooking. She has now been waiting for the licence for three years!
The current team of volunteers are doing an incredible job – led by Helen O’Sullivan – who will be sadly missed when she returns to the UK in December. We realise what a need there is for qualified teachers who are perhaps able to volunteer for a year, rather than a few months, in order to give continuity to the children’s education.
